Scout was back at the same spot that he logged off, just outside of the Adventurers guild. Scout went back inside and approached the counter, the same Elf was there.
"Hello, how may I help you today?" The elf asked
"Im here to pick up my adventurers card please."
"And what is your name again?"
"Scout"
"Scout, Scout, oh here it is, here you go." The Elf then handed over scout a white piece of card the size was of a regular ID
"Would you like a basic overview on how the adventurers card works?"
Scout just nodded and said "Yes please"
"Okay, well first of all, you need to drop a tiny amount of blood onto your card."
Scout then pulled out his dagger and nicked his finger just enough for blood to come out, he then let the blood drop onto the white piece of card. It suddenly changed color, There was a split in color, in one half of the card, it was white, while the other was blue. And the word 'SCOUT' was printed and carved in the middle.
"Ooooh thats amazing to think that you are halfway to being a blue tier adventurer already." The Elf said with a joyous smile on her face.
". . ." Scout was confused because he still did not know what it meant.
"Ah pardon my rudeness, I still haven't explain the how the card works. Basically the card will determine your strength, and the card shows that by the color that it holds. The rankings are, White, Blue, Green, Yellow, Orange, Pink, Purple, and Black. White being the weakest and Black being the strongest. But the card only reads the adventurers stats, and those stats include the equipment bonuses. So it doesn't necessarily mean that Blue tiered adventurers are stronger than white tiered ones. But the chances are pretty high for higher tiered color to be stronger than the ones below them."
"I see, but what about my card, its half white and half blue, what does that mean?" Scout asked after the long explanation.
"It just means your halfway to being a blue tiered adventurer, you are still considered a white tiered adventurer, and the quests you can take are still only white tiered quests. You can still go on higher colored quests if you are in a group that has 2 colored tier above you, since you are a white tiered, you can technically join green tiered quest if they accept you into their group. Also if you rank up to a higher tier color, you can still take on quests from the lower tiered quests."
"Thank you very much for the explanation, since I have my card, can I go do quests now?" Scout again asked.
"Yes, just take a poster from the quest board, and hand over the poster to one of the open windows right beside it and show them your card, they need to approve that your card color corresponds to the quest."
Scout then walked over to the quest board, there weren't that many quests available since it was the beginner town, and all of the quests they had available were white tiered ones.
There was one quest that was pretty easy for scout to do. It was to gather 75 bunny meat and bunny fur, lucky for Scout he already has the same exact number from all the bunnies that he killed. So he grabbed the poster and gave it to one of the workers on the window along with his card. A notification then popped up.

Quest:Collect 75 bunny meat and fur
Rewards:Experience and 50 copper
Accept?Yes/No
"Accept quest."
Scout then asked the window person "Where do I turn in the quest?"
The guy working the window was dumbfounded "But you just got that quest, just now."
"I hunted them yesterday" Scout said with a laugh.
"I-I see, you can hand them over to any of us working the windows."
Scout then took out the 75 bunny meat and bunny furs and handed over to the teller.
Quest Complete
After he turned in the quest, Scout got a level, and he assigned his stats the same as before, 2 in strength and 2 in agility and 1 in luck.
'Well that was easy' Scout thought with a grin in his face, he then went over back to the quest board and checked what other quests he can do. There was one quest that interested him, it was herb picking, he needed to pick up 1000 level 1 herbs for the local pharmacists in order to create level 1 potions. Scout accepted the job and started to head out towards the fields.
Once Scout was out in the field, he easily saw the level 1 herbs and started digging around the roots and uprooted the level 1 herb.
You gathered Level 1 Herb x 1
Scout was satisfied, he started picking and picking and after a couple of hours of picking the herbs, there were no more herbs to pick up, he had gathered 50 herbs. 'I guess theres a limit to how many herbs spawn each day' Scout thought disappointed. This would mean it would take Scout 20 days to finish the quest, and since Scout already took 5 in game days before, he only will be left 5 more in game days to do nothing.
Scout decided on a plan that most people won't even bother doing since it would be boring. His plan was every time he finished picking up the herbs, he would hunt bunnies to increase his dagger mastery and his backstab skill.
Scout did this for 20 days, stopping only for his daily necessities like exercising, using the bathroom, eating and sleeping. On occasion he would encounter Player killers, about once every 2 days, of course, Scout dealt with them without the Player Killers knowing, one second they were killing other players, the next, they were dead. Scout gained 7 levels from that he is now level 13. His Dagger mastery increased to beginner level 7, and since he can only use backstab so very often, it only leveled up to beginner level 5.
After picking up 1000th level 1 herb he gained a notification.
Congratulations:You learned the herb picking skill, you can now pick up herbs faster and there is a slight chance of picking up 2 or more herbs from a single herb.
Herb Picking: 0% (Beginner level 1)
'Why didnt the stupid system give this to me when I started?! I could have killed more bunnies!' Scout was mad, but happy at the same time, since he got a new skill.'
Scout went back to the beginner town to sell all of his bunny meat and bunny fur. Since he killed almost 1 thousand bunnies, he got about 300 bunny meat and fur each, which the adventurers guild gracefully bought from Scout for 3 coppers each meat and fur. That brought Scout money to 60 silver. He had 80 coppers before, but he used them for his supplies during his mission.

He went back to the adventurers guild and turned in his quest. He went to the window and was about to hand the herbs over, but the NPC told him "Oh you're finished picking up the 1000 herbs? Not many have the same patience as you. Anyway, the pharmacists that wanted those herbs requested that people take the 1000 herbs to him personally."
"I see, I do not know where he is though" Scout said while scratching his head.
"Here let me mark it on your map"
"Thank you very much."
Scout left the adventurers guild and started walking over to the red dot in his map, and after 5 minutes of walking he saw the pharmacists shop right next door to the alchemy shop.
(Note, in this game, Pharmacists create health potions, and Alchemists create mana potions.)
Scout stepped inside the shop and approached the counter where an old man was standing.
"Welcome, would you like to buy some potions young man?"
"No, I'm here to turn in the 1000 herb quest?"
"Ah, not many adventurers finish that quest."
"So I have been told" Scout said, he then gave the 1000 herbs to the old man.
"Thank you very much young man, here let me bestow upon you this profession, I only give this skill to those that pass this quest."
Congratulations:You are now a Pharmacist, you can now create health potions depending on your level of pharmacist.
Pharmacist level: 1
'This is gonna be very useful for me' Scout thought with a grin. "Thank you very much, but how does it work?"
"Ah, almost forgot to tell you eh? Its pretty simple really, you just grab one of the herbs, grind it up, and put it in a special glass vial. The vial already contains the liquid that automatically mixes the herb with the liquid. So 1 herb and 1 vial is one potion."
"I see" Scout said with a nod. "But where can I get the vials?"
"They can only be bought from alchemy or pharmacy shops, and they are only 10 copper each"
"Okay, can I buy 250 please?"
"250 young man? That is going to be 25 silver, can you afford it?"
"Yes" Scout then handed over the 25 silver and got 250 vials.
"Thanks for the business" The old man said.
Scout then left the store. Scout still had 5 game days left after this one, so he can still gather 250 herbs, thats why he bought 250 vials. He then logged off and decided to log back in after 6 hours in real time since that would be 1 in game day since the time ratio is 1:4.
Ray stepped out of his 'Egg' and did his daily routine, exercise, eat, bathroom and sleep. He then logged back on, collected his 50 herbs, logged back out and relaxed. He did this until it was already his 30th in game day. Ray logged back in Square One.
As Scout was being spawned from where he last logged off, he started picking up his 50 last herbs. After picking up herbs for 5 days, Scout got his Herb Picking skill up to beginner level 3. He then got a window.
Congratulations: Your 30 days are up, please head to the adventurers guild so that you will be given your class and you will be transported to an actual beginner town.
Scout rushed towards the adventurers guild, he approached the counter and asked where he could get his class. The person at the counter pointed him towards a door, on top of the door, two words were carved "CLASS CHANGE". Scout face palmed, it couldn't have been more obvious.
He went inside the door and there was something surprising inside, he saw the noble that he had escorted on his very first day. Whats even more surprising is that he was the one that was giving out the class change.
"Hey, good to see you, so you're finally ready to take on your class?"
Scout just nodded, he wanted to hide his excitement.
"Well just like told you, a good class will be given to you, I'm not the one that chooses this, I'm just the one that our God, Gaia has chosen to bestow classes to adventurers like you."
A window then suddenly showed up in front of Scout.
Congratulations!You have been offered the class Eliminator you are offered this class because due to your behaviors, killing thief's and adventurer killers without bragging about it, or showing it off to other adventurers. Note that this class is a class somewhere along the lines of a thief and a rouge. All fame and infamy will be reset. You will not gain any fame for killing players for it is in your nature, you can still gain fame for doing righteous things and by doing unique quests, NPCS will only talk of you through your righteous deeds and quests, but never as a player that kills other players. Your infamy will not go up if you kill non player killers depending on the situation, since there can only be one truth, God Gaia will know and decide wether or not you gain any infamy.
Accept? Yes/No
If you do not accept you will be given another class as an "Assassin"
"Accept" Scout paid did not care about his fame, since he really does not want to stand out, this would work best for him.
Congratulations you are now an Eliminator
"Well kid, like I told you, unique class eh?"
"Yeah, thank you very much."
"Don't thank me kid, thank Gaia."
Scout nodded.
"Well our times up kid, you will now be transferred to an actually starting town somewhere in the regions of Chronos, its pretty random. Good luck and have fun kid, your adventure begins now!."
All light begin to fade around Scout and he soon woke opened his eyes on a new town, a whole new world.
